Common Causes of Pipe Blockages
Understanding what causes pipe issues helps you take better care of your plumbing system. Most household clogs are caused by everyday habits, such as:
Grease and oil buildup from cooking that hardens inside pipes
Hair accumulation in bathroom drains
Soap residue sticking to pipe walls
Food waste entering kitchen sinks
Foreign objects accidentally flushed or washed down drains
Hard water minerals that gradually narrow pipe openings

Avoid Pouring Grease Down the Sink
Grease is one of the biggest enemies of plumbing systems. Even small amounts can solidify and stick to pipe walls. Instead of washing it down the drain, collect grease in a container and dispose of it properly. Use Drain Screens
Installing simple drain screens in sinks, showers, and tubs can significantly reduce clogging. These screens catch hair, food particles, and debris before they enter your pipes. Warning Signs You Need a drain cleaning service
Your plumbing system usually gives warning signs before a major blockage occurs. Recognizing these early can save you from costly repairs.
Slow draining sinks or tubs
Gurgling noises coming from pipes
Foul odors from drains
Water backing up into sinks or toilets
Frequent clogging even after cleaning

How a drain cleaning service Works
A professional drain cleaning service uses advanced tools and techniques that are far more effective than home remedies. Some of the most common methods include:
High-Pressure Water Jetting
This method uses powerful streams of water to break apart grease, sludge, and debris stuck inside pipes. It is one of the most efficient ways to restore full water flow without damaging the plumbing system.
Drain Snaking
A specialized cable tool is inserted into the pipe to physically break or pull out blockages. This method is often used for hair clogs or solid obstructions.
Camera Inspections
Modern drain cleaning service providers often use waterproof cameras to inspect the inside of pipes. This helps identify hidden issues such as cracks, deep blockages, or root intrusion.
Chemical Cleaning Solutions
In some cases, safe and professional-grade cleaning solutions are used to dissolve stubborn buildup. These are applied carefully to avoid damaging pipes while restoring proper flow.
